3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side
TL;DR: 3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side (CAS 65914-17-2) is a chemical compound with molecular formula C20H22O8 and molecular weight 390.13 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
(2S,3R,4S,5S,6R)-2-[3-hydroxy-5-[2-(4-hydroxyphenyl)ethenyl]phenoxy]-6-(hydroxymethyl)oxane-3,4,5-triol
Also Known As: Polydatin, Piceid, Polydatin CRS, resveratrol-3-O-beta-d-glucopyranoside, (2S,3R,4S,5S,6R)-2-(3-Hydroxy-5-(4-hydroxystyryl)phenoxy)-6-(hydroxymethyl)tetrahydro-2H-pyran-3,4,5-triol
| Molecular Formula | C20H22O8 |
|---|---|
| Molecular Weight | 390.13 g/mol |
| LogP | 1.7 |
| Topological Polar Surface Area | 140.0 Ų |
| Hydrogen Bond Donors | 6 |
| Hydrogen Bond Acceptors | 8 |
| Rotatable Bonds | 5 |
| Exact Mass | 390.13147 |
| Heavy Atoms | 28 |
| Complexity | 506.0 |
Chemical Identifiers
| CAS Number | 65914-17-2 |
|---|---|
| SMILES | C1=CC(=CC=C1C=CC2=CC(=CC(=C2)O[C@H]3[C@@H]([C@H]([C@@H]([C@H](O3)CO)O)O)O)O)O |
| InChIKey | HSTZMXCBWJGKHG-OUUBHVDSSA-N |

Chemical Property Profile of 3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side
Property Insights of 3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side
The XLogP value of 1.7 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side. The TPSA of 140.0 Ų indicates high polarity, suggesting 3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, 3-Hydroxy-5-(2-(4-hydroxyphenyl)ethenyl)phenyl-beta-D-glucopyranoside has 6 hydrogen bond donor(s) and 8 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
